Solr管理员证书不起作用
问题描述:
我们遵循此链接中的回答2个步骤,它不适用于Solr Cloud 6.0.3环境。Solr管理员证书不起作用
How to set Apache solr admin password
但它是在正常的主/从工作的罚款。
答
在SolrCloud模式下,您应该使用内置的Authentication and Authorization support。
您可以通过上传security.json
文件到您的动物园管理员合奏启用:
{
"authentication":{
"blockUnknown": true,
"class":"solr.BasicAuthPlugin",
"credentials":{"solr":"IV0EHq1OnNrj6gvRCwvFwTrZ1+z1oBbnQdiVC3otuq0= Ndd7LKvVBAaZIF0QAVi1ekCfAJXr1GGfLtRUXhgrF8c="}
},
"authorization":{
"class":"solr.RuleBasedAuthorizationPlugin",
"permissions":[{"name":"security-edit",
"role":"admin"}],
"user-role":{"solr":"admin"}
}}
有several different authentication plugins available - 的例子是从BasicAuthentication模块。
将安全编辑更改为所有权限将限制所有内容。 “权限”:[{ “Name”: “所有”, – Sara